Strengthen your horse's immune system and manage coughing

Causes of coughing in horses

A common cause of coughing in horses is a dusty environment and poor ventilation in the stable. Horses that are exposed to dusty environments or fed dusty hay can develop irritation in the airways. Therefore, it is important to ensure a good stable environment with regular cleaning and proper ventilation. Using dust-free bedding and wet hay or haylage can also help reduce the risk of irritation.

Allergies can also lead to coughing and respiratory issues in horses. Common allergens include mold, pollen, and dust mites. If your horse shows signs of allergies, it may be necessary to adjust their environment and diet to minimize exposure to these allergens.

Infections in horses

Respiratory infections

Respiratory infections, such as bronchitis or pneumonia, can also cause coughing in horses. These conditions can be caused by bacteria, viruses, or fungi and may require treatment with antibiotics or other medications. A veterinarian should always be consulted for proper diagnosis and treatment.

Ch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D)

COPD, also known as "heaves" or "dust allergy," is a chronic lung disease in horses similar to asthma in humans. Symptoms include coughing, labored breathing, and nasal discharge. Management involves environmental changes and sometimes medication to aid breathing.
